CVE-2026-27833
Piwigo is an open source photo gallery application for the web. Prior to version 16.3.0, the pwg.history.search API method in Piwigo is registered without the adminonly option, allowing unauthenticated users to access the full browsing history of all gallery visitors. SUSE CVE-2008-4696
Cross-site scripting XSS vulnerability in Opera.dll in Opera before 9.61 all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the anchor identifier aka the "optional fragment", which is not properly escaped before storage in the History Search database aka md.dat...
